The Rise of M. Night Shyamalan

M. Night Shyamalan burst onto the cinematic scene in the late 1990s with his groundbreaking film, "The Sixth Sense" (1999). This psychological thriller not only captivated audiences but also established Shyamalan as a master of suspense and a unique voice in Hollywood. With its iconic twist ending, "The Sixth Sense" became a cultural phenomenon, earning Shyamalan two Academy Award nominations and solidifying his reputation as a talented storyteller.

Following the success of "The Sixth Sense," Shyamalan continued to create films that showcased his distinctive narrative style. "Unbreakable" (2000) and "Signs" (2002) further demonstrated his ability to blend supernatural elements with profound human emotions. The Critical Reception of Shyamalan's Films

The reception of Shyamalan's films has varied significantly over the years. While early works like "The Sixth Sense" and "Unbreakable" received critical acclaim, later projects faced scrutiny. Notably, "The Village" (2004) and "Lady in the Water" (2006) were met with mixed reviews, leading some critics to question Shyamalan's creative direction.

One of the most polarizing entries in Shyamalan's filmography is "The Happening" (2008), which was widely criticized for its premise and execution. Critics panned the film's dialogue and performances, leading to a significant shift in public perception regarding Shyamalan's capabilities as a director. Despite this, Shyamalan has continued to produce films, including "The Visit" (2015) and "Split" (2016), both of which received more favorable reviews.

Box Office Performance vs. Critical Acclaim

Another aspect to consider when evaluating Shyamalan's career is the relationship between box office performance and critical acclaim. While some of his films have underperformed at the box office, others have achieved commercial success despite mixed reviews. For instance, "Split" grossed over $278 million worldwide, showcasing Shyamalan's ability to draw audiences even when critical reception is lukewarm.

This dichotomy raises the question: does box office success equate to directorial talent? Many would argue that a director's worth should be measured by their ability to tell engaging stories and connect with audiences rather than solely relying on critical accolades.

Shyamalan's Evolution as a Director

As with any artist, M. Night Shyamalan's directorial style has evolved over the years. After experiencing both critical and commercial setbacks, he has taken steps to adapt and refine his craft. In recent years, Shyamalan has embraced a more grounded approach to storytelling, focusing on character development and emotional resonance.

Films like "The Visit" and "Split" represent a return to form for Shyamalan, showcasing his ability to create suspenseful narratives while also exploring complex characters. This evolution may indicate that Shyamalan is not a bad director but rather one who is continuously learning and adapting to the changing landscape of cinema.

Impact on the Horror Genre

M. Night Shyamalan's contributions to the horror genre cannot be overlooked. His ability to blend psychological elements with supernatural themes has influenced a new generation of filmmakers. Films like "The Sixth Sense" and "Signs" have set a standard for tension and atmosphere that many contemporary horror films strive to emulate.

Moreover, Shyamalan's unique approach to horror often emphasizes the human experience, focusing on the emotional responses of characters rather than relying solely on jump scares or gore. This emphasis on character-driven storytelling has resonated with audiences and has solidified Shyamalan's place in the horror film canon.
